The Science Behind Microwaving

Microwave ovens are designed to emit microwaves, a type of non-ionizing radiation. These waves cause water, fat, and sugar molecules in food to vibrate, generating heat:

  • Non-Ionizing Radiation: Unlike ionizing radiation, which can damage DNA and increase cancer risk, non-ionizing radiation has much less energy and is not considered harmful.
  • Increased Efficiency: Microwaves cook food evenly and quickly, often in a fraction of the time it takes using conventional ovens or stovetops.

Health Concerns: Is Cooking in the Microwave Safe?

One of the primary concerns surrounding microwave cooking is whether it poses any health risks. Let’s explore some of the common fears associated with microwave usage.

Potential Health Risks

  1. Nutrient Loss: One common concern is that microwaving food can diminish its nutritional value. While it is true that some nutrients can be lost during any form of cooking, studies have shown that microwaving can preserve more nutrients compared to boiling or pan-frying. This preservation occurs due to shorter cooking times and less water usage, which reduces nutrient leaching.

  2. Chemical Contaminants: Many worry about leaching chemicals from containers into food when microwaved. Some plastics, especially those not labeled as “microwave-safe,” can release harmful chemicals like BPA (Bisphenol A) when exposed to heat. It is crucial to use containers that are specifically designed for microwave use.

  3. Uneven Heating: Another concern is that microwaved food may heat unevenly, leading to cold spots where bacteria can survive. To mitigate this, always stir or rotate your food halfway through cooking, and utilize a food thermometer to ensure all parts reach the recommended temperature of 165°F (74°C).

Best Practices for Safe Microwave Cooking

To ensure that you are safely cooking in the microwave, consider the following best practices:

Use Microwave-Safe Containers

Always choose containers that are labeled as microwave-safe. Glass, ceramic, and some plastics are typically safe options. Avoid using:

  • Metal containers
  • Styrofoam containers not specifically labeled for microwave use

Reheat Food Properly

When reheating leftovers, ensure that they reach the proper temperature throughout. Use a food thermometer to check that reheated food is at least 165°F (74°C).

Cover Your Food

Covering your food with a microwave-safe lid or vented plastic wrap can help prevent splatters and retain moisture, ensuring even cooking. Ventilation is crucial, as it allows steam to escape and prevents potential explosions.

The Importance of Stirring and Rotating

As mentioned, stirring and rotating food halfway through cooking can help distribute heat evenly, eliminating any cold spots that might harbor bacteria.

Debunking Microwave Myths

Several myths concerning microwave cooking may fuel your apprehension. Let’s debunk some of the most prevalent ones:

Myth 1: Microwaves Cause Cancer

This myth arises mainly from misunderstanding microwave radiation. As previously stated, microwave ovens utilize non-ionizing radiation that does not have enough energy to alter molecular structures, including DNA. Therefore, there is no evidence to suggest that using a microwave oven increases your cancer risk.

Myth 2: Microwaves Cook Food from the Inside Out

In reality, microwaves penetrate food to a depth of about 1 inch (2.5 cm). The process of cooking then continues outward as heat dissipates from the inside. This means that even though the microwave heats quickly, the cooking process balances itself out over time.

Myth 3: Microwaves Destroy Nutrients

As previously discussed, a study indicated that microwaving food can actually help retain certain vitamins and minerals when compared to boiling methods. For example, cooking broccoli in the microwave can preserve up to 90% of its vitamin C content, while boiling can significantly diminish this nutrient.

Do microwaves kill bacteria in food?

Microwaves can effectively kill bacteria, provided that the food reaches the appropriate internal temperature for a sufficient amount of time. The key to achieving this is to ensure even cooking throughout the food. If certain parts of the food are left undercooked, bacteria may survive and pose health risks.

For optimal results, it is advisable to stir, flip, or rotate food during cooking and to let it stand for a brief period afterward. This standing time allows heat to distribute more evenly, giving any remaining bacteria a chance to be killed. Using a food thermometer to confirm that the food has reached the recommended safe temperature is also a good practice.

Is it safe to microwave eggs in their shells?

Microwaving eggs in their shells is not safe, as the steam produced during cooking can cause the egg to explode. The shell traps steam, and if there is no outlet for that steam to escape, it builds up pressure until the shell bursts. This can create a messy situation inside your microwave and pose a risk of injury.

Instead, if you want to cook eggs in the microwave, crack them into a microwave-safe container. You can whisk the eggs or leave them whole, but make sure to pierce the yolk with a fork to allow steam to escape. Cover the dish loosely to prevent splatter, and microwave in short intervals while stirring until the eggs are fully cooked.

Can microwaving affect the nutritional value of food?

Microwaving food typically preserves its nutritional value better than some other cooking methods, such as boiling or frying. Because microwaving cooks food quickly and often requires little to no added water, it can help retainheat-sensitive vitamins and minerals. The shorter cooking time means that fewer nutrients are lost in the cooking process.

That said, the way food is prepared and the cooking time can still impact its nutritional content. For example, overcooking vegetables in the microwave may lead to a loss of nutrients. To retain the maximum nutritional value, it is advisable to cook food just until tender and avoid excessive cooking times.

Are there any health risks associated with microwave cooking?

While microwave cooking is generally considered safe, there are some health risks to be aware of. One concern is the potential for microwave-safe containers to leach harmful chemicals into food when heated. For instance, certain plastics can release bisphenol A (BPA) or phthalates when subjected to high temperatures. To minimize risk, always use containers labeled as microwave-safe and avoid using old or damaged containers.

Another concern is related to uneven heating, which can leave some areas of the food undercooked. This creates an opportunity for harmful bacteria to survive, posing a risk of foodborne illness. To combat this risk, it’s essential to follow proper reheating guidelines, use a food thermometer when necessary, and ensure that food is heated thoroughly and evenly.
